Pagina 2 di 4 primaprima 1 2 3 4 ultimoultimo
Visualizzazione dei risultati da 11 a 20 su 38
  1. #11
    ti ho detto di fare la conn.execute... dov'è?
    poi, che db usi?

  2. #12
    Utente di HTML.it L'avatar di serpiko
    Registrato dal
    Feb 2005
    Messaggi
    346
    ho provato anche così ma lo stesso non restituisce errori ma non cambia nemmeno la categoria!:
    codice:
    '---------------------inizio riga per cambiare la categoria-------------------------------
    if objRS("scadenza") > date() then
    Dim Conn
    Set Conn=Server.CreateObject("ADODB.Connection")
    Conn.Open "driver={Microsoft Access Driver (*.mdb)};dbq="& server.MapPath("db/db.mdb")	
    SQL="UPDATE db SET cat=scaduto WHERE scadenza > date()"
    Conn.Execute(SQL)
    end if
    '---------------------fine riga per cambiare la categoria-------------------------------
    attenta allo sportello quando scendi!!!!

  3. #13
    Utente di HTML.it L'avatar di serpiko
    Registrato dal
    Feb 2005
    Messaggi
    346
    Mi spiego meglio adesso il codice è così:
    codice:
    <%
    			
    			iPageSize = 10 'NUMERO RECORD PER PAGINA
    
    			If Request.QueryString("page") = "" Then
    				iPageCurrent = 1
    			Else
    				iPageCurrent = CInt(Request.QueryString("page"))
    			End If
    
    			strSQL = "SELECT * FROM db where cat = 'bandi' or cat = 'Avvisi' order by data DESC"
    			Set objRS = Server.CreateObject("ADODB.Recordset")
    			objRS.PageSize = iPageSize
    			objRS.CacheSize = iPageSize
    			objRS.Open strSQL, objConn, adOpenStatic, adLockReadOnly, adCmdText
    
    			reccount = objRS.recordcount
    			iPageCount = objRS.PageCount
    
    			If iPageCurrent > iPageCount Then iPageCurrent = iPageCount
    			If iPageCurrent < 1 Then iPageCurrent = 1
    
    			If iPageCount = 0 Then
    				Response.Write "
    
    <table><td><font face='verdana' size='2' color='#000000'>Non sono stati trovati dati.</td></table></p>"
    			Else
    				objRS.AbsolutePage = iPageCurrent
    				iRecordsShown = 0
    				%>
                                  <table>
                                    <%
    								cont=1
    								Do While iRecordsShown < iPageSize And Not objRS.EOF
    									
    dim colore, colore2, scadenza, rsEventi	
    colore="#ff0000"
    colore2="#000000"		
     If objRS("cat") = "Bandi" Then
    
    									    							
    									Response.Write "<tr><td>[img]immagini/jpg/zipimage_p.jpg[/img]<span class=""titolonews"">"&objRS("nome")&"</span>
    
    "& vbCrlf
    									Response.Write "<font color='"& Colore2 &"' face='Verdana' size='1'>Inserito il [" & objRS("data") & "] </font>
    
    [img][/img]</td></tr>"
    									Else
    									Response.write " <TR><TD bgcolor=""#FF0000""><div align=""center""><font color=""#FFFFFF"" size=""2"" face=""Geneva, Arial, Helvetica, sans-serif"">AVVISO</font></div></TD></TR>"
    									Response.Write "<tr><td>[img]immagini/jpg/zipimage_p.jpg[/img]<span class=""titolonews"">"&objRS("nome")&"</span>
    
    "& vbCrlf
    									Response.Write "<font color='"& Colore &"' face='Verdana' size='1'>Inserito il [" & objRS("data") & "] </font>
    </td></tr>"
    									Response.Write "<TR><TD bgcolor=""#FF0000""><div align=""center""></div></TD></TR>"
    									end if
    '---------------------inizio riga per cambiare la categoria-------------------------------
    if objRS("scadenza") > date() then
    Dim Conn
    Set Conn=Server.CreateObject("ADODB.Connection")
    Conn.Open "driver={Microsoft Access Driver (*.mdb)};dbq="& server.MapPath("db/db.mdb")	
    SQL="UPDATE db SET cat=scaduto WHERE scadenza > date()"
    Conn.Execute(SQL)
    end if
    '---------------------fine riga per cambiare la categoria-------------------------------
    									Cont = Cont + 1
    									'POSIZIONAMENTO ALLA RIGA SUCCESSIVA DEL DB
    									iRecordsShown = iRecordsShown + 1
    									objRS.MoveNext
    								Loop
    								'PULIZIA DEGLI OGGETTI ADO
    								objRS.Close
    								Set objRS = Nothing
    								%>
                                  </table>
                                  <%End if%>
                                  
    
     
                                    <%If ipagecount <> 1 Then%>
                                  </p>
                                  <table>
                                    <tr> 
                                      <td width="50%"><font face="verdana" size="1" color="#000000"> 
                                        [ 
                                        <%if iPageCurrent-2 > 0 and iPageCurrent > 2 then%>
                                        [img]images/first.gif[/img] 
                                        <%end if%>
                                        <%if iPageCurrent > 1 then%>
                                        [img]images/pre.gif[/img] 
                                        <%end if%>
                                        <%if iPageCount > 2 then
    								if iPageCurrent-2 < 1 then da_pag = 1 else da_pag = iPageCurrent-2
    								if iPageCurrent+2 > iPageCount then fino_a_pag = iPageCount else fino_a_pag = iPageCurrent+2
    							else
    								da_pag = 1
    								fino_a_pag = iPageCount
    							end if%>
                                        <%for i = da_pag to fino_a_pag%>
                                        <%if i = iPageCurrent then%>
                                        <font color="red"> <%=i%> </font> 
                                        <%else%>
                                        <a href="bandi.asp?page=<%=i%>"> <%=i%> 
                                        </a> 
                                        <%end if%>
                                        <%next%>
                                        <%if iPageCurrent > 0 and iPageCurrent < iPageCount then%>
                                        [img]images/next.gif[/img] 
                                        <%end if%>
                                        <%if iPageCurrent+1 < iPageCount then%>
                                        [img]images/last.gif[/img] 
                                        <%end if%>
                                        ] </font></td>
                                    </tr>
                                    <tr> 
                                      <td colspan="2" align="left"><font face="verdana" size="1" color="#000000"> 
                                        Pagina <font color="#FF0000"> <%=iPageCurrent%> 
                                        </font> di <font color="#FF0000"> 
                                        <%=iPageCount%> </font> </font></td>
                                    </tr>
                                  </table>
                                  <%end if%>
                                  <%
    			objConn.Close
    			Set objConn = Nothing
    			%>
    non restituisce errori ma nemmeno cambia la categoria del record!
    attenta allo sportello quando scendi!!!!

  4. #14
    Utente di HTML.it L'avatar di serpiko
    Registrato dal
    Feb 2005
    Messaggi
    346
    Niente non capisco dove sbaglio!
    aiutatemi! potete? mé!
    attenta allo sportello quando scendi!!!!

  5. #15
    Utente di HTML.it L'avatar di serpiko
    Registrato dal
    Feb 2005
    Messaggi
    346
    ditemi dove sbaglio... come fare 'nsomma!
    up!!!!!!!!
    attenta allo sportello quando scendi!!!!

  6. #16
    sorry, la fretta

    UPDATE tabella SET campo=scaduto WHERE scadenza < oggi

  7. #17
    Utente di HTML.it L'avatar di serpiko
    Registrato dal
    Feb 2005
    Messaggi
    346
    beh si! effettivamente è decisamente meglio < che maggiore in ogni caso sono ancora fermo... non riesco quale dei codici che ho postato poco prima va bene secondo voi!? perché continua a non effettuare nessuna modifica al record!
    attenta allo sportello quando scendi!!!!

  8. #18
    in che formato è il campo 'scadenza' ?

  9. #19
    Utente di HTML.it L'avatar di serpiko
    Registrato dal
    Feb 2005
    Messaggi
    346
    data/ora
    se può tornarti utile all'inizio del post ho specificato tutta la struttura della tabella
    attenta allo sportello quando scendi!!!!

  10. #20
    Utente di HTML.it L'avatar di serpiko
    Registrato dal
    Feb 2005
    Messaggi
    346
    ops... forse intendevi questo:
    il formato è gg/mm/aaaa
    attenta allo sportello quando scendi!!!!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.